Grace Brilhante of Warren, who works as a patient accounts representative, ambulatory registration, at Hasbro Children’s Hospital, was named one of the hospital’s 2021 Brite Lite award winners during a gathering in the hospital’s Balise Healing Garden on Monday.
Honorees are Lifespan employees who are nominated by Hasbro Children’s Hospital patients and their families for the dedication and compassion shown to children under their care. Launched in 2002, the Brite Lite employee recognition program highlights five employees who have gone above and beyond their everyday duties to make patients and families with whom they come into contact feel safe, important, and well cared for. Brite Lites are chosen as those who best characterize “the four Cs” at Hasbro Children’s Hospital: caring, communication, cooperation and competence.
